Nota
O acesso a esta página requer autorização. Pode tentar iniciar sessão ou alterar os diretórios.
O acesso a esta página requer autorização. Pode tentar alterar os diretórios.
Note
Essas informações se aplicam às versões 0.205 e superiores da CLI do Databricks. A CLI do Databricks está em Pré-Visualização Pública.
O uso da CLI do Databricks está sujeito à Licença do Databricks e ao Aviso de Privacidade do Databricks, incluindo quaisquer disposições de Dados de Uso.
O knowledge-assistants grupo de comandos dentro da CLI Databricks permite-lhe gerir Assistentes de Conhecimento e recursos relacionados.
Databricks assistentes de conhecimento criar-assistente de conhecimento
Crie um Assistente de Conhecimento.
databricks knowledge-assistants create-knowledge-assistant DISPLAY_NAME DESCRIPTION [flags]
Arguments
DISPLAY_NAME
O nome de exibição do Assistente de Conhecimento, único ao nível do espaço de trabalho.
DESCRIPTION
Descrição do que este assistente pode fazer (de frente ao utilizador).
Opções
--instructions string
Instruções globais adicionais sobre como o agente deve gerar respostas.
--json JSON
A cadeia de caracteres JSON embutida ou o @path para o arquivo JSON com o corpo da solicitação.
--name string
O nome do recurso do Assistente de Conhecimento.
Examples
O exemplo seguinte cria um Assistente de Conhecimento:
databricks knowledge-assistants create-knowledge-assistant "Sales Assistant" "Answers questions about sales data"
Databricks Knowledge-Assistants criar-knowledge-source
Crie uma fonte de conhecimento através de um Assistente de Conhecimento.
databricks knowledge-assistants create-knowledge-source PARENT DISPLAY_NAME DESCRIPTION SOURCE_TYPE [flags]
Arguments
PARENT
Recurso parental onde esta fonte será criada. Formato: knowledge-assistants/{knowledge_assistant_id}.
DISPLAY_NAME
Nome de visualização legível por humanos da fonte de conhecimento.
DESCRIPTION
Descrição da fonte de conhecimento.
SOURCE_TYPE
O tipo da fonte. Valores suportados: index, files, file_table.
Opções
--json JSON
A cadeia de caracteres JSON embutida ou o @path para o arquivo JSON com o corpo da solicitação.
--name string
Nome completo do recurso: knowledge-assistants/{knowledge_assistant_id}/knowledge-sources/{knowledge_source_id}.
Examples
O exemplo seguinte cria uma fonte de conhecimento:
databricks knowledge-assistants create-knowledge-source knowledge-assistants/my-assistant-id "Sales Docs" "Documentation about sales processes" files
databricks assistentes-de conhecimento eliminar-assistente de conhecimento
Apaga um assistente de conhecimento.
databricks knowledge-assistants delete-knowledge-assistant NAME [flags]
Arguments
NAME
O nome do recurso do assistente de conhecimento a eliminar. Formato: knowledge-assistants/{knowledge_assistant_id}.
Opções
Examples
O exemplo seguinte elimina um Assistente de Conhecimento:
databricks knowledge-assistants delete-knowledge-assistant knowledge-assistants/my-assistant-id
databricks knowledge-assistants eliminar-knowledge-source
Apagar uma fonte de conhecimento.
databricks knowledge-assistants delete-knowledge-source NAME [flags]
Arguments
NAME
O nome do recurso da fonte de conhecimento a eliminar. Formato: knowledge-assistants/{knowledge_assistant_id}/knowledge-sources/{knowledge_source_id}.
Opções
Examples
O exemplo seguinte elimina uma fonte de conhecimento:
databricks knowledge-assistants delete-knowledge-source knowledge-assistants/my-assistant-id/knowledge-sources/my-source-id
databricks assistentes de conhecimento obtenham-assistente de conhecimento
Arranja um assistente de conhecimento.
databricks knowledge-assistants get-knowledge-assistant NAME [flags]
Arguments
NAME
O nome do recurso do assistente de conhecimento. Formato: knowledge-assistants/{knowledge_assistant_id}.
Opções
Examples
O exemplo seguinte recebe um Assistente de Conhecimento:
databricks knowledge-assistants get-knowledge-assistant knowledge-assistants/my-assistant-id
Databricks Knowledge-Assistants get-knowledge-source
Arranja uma fonte de conhecimento.
databricks knowledge-assistants get-knowledge-source NAME [flags]
Arguments
NAME
O nome do recurso da fonte de conhecimento. Formato: knowledge-assistants/{knowledge_assistant_id}/knowledge-sources/{knowledge_source_id}.
Opções
Examples
O exemplo seguinte recebe uma fonte de conhecimento:
databricks knowledge-assistants get-knowledge-source knowledge-assistants/my-assistant-id/knowledge-sources/my-source-id
Databricks Lista-Assistentes-de Conhecimento-Assistentes de Conhecimento
Lista de Assistentes de Conhecimento.
databricks knowledge-assistants list-knowledge-assistants [flags]
Arguments
None
Opções
--page-size int
O número máximo de assistentes de conhecimento a regressar.
--page-token string
Um token de página, recebido de uma chamada anterior list-knowledge-assistants .
Examples
O exemplo seguinte lista todos os Assistentes de Conhecimento:
databricks knowledge-assistants list-knowledge-assistants
Databricks Lista de Assistentes de Conhecimento-Fontes-Conhecimento
Liste as fontes de conhecimento sob um Assistente de Conhecimento.
databricks knowledge-assistants list-knowledge-sources PARENT [flags]
Arguments
PARENT
Recurso para pais para listar. Formato: knowledge-assistants/{knowledge_assistant_id}.
Opções
--page-size int
O número máximo de fontes de conhecimento para regressar.
--page-token string
Um token de página de uma chamada de lista anterior.
Examples
O exemplo seguinte lista fontes de conhecimento para um assistente:
databricks knowledge-assistants list-knowledge-sources knowledge-assistants/my-assistant-id
Databricks Assistentes-de Conhecimento Sincronização-Fontes-Conhecimento
Sincronize todas as fontes de conhecimento que não sejam indexadas para um Assistente de Conhecimento. As fontes de índice não requerem sincronização.
databricks knowledge-assistants sync-knowledge-sources NAME [flags]
Arguments
NAME
O nome do recurso do Assistente de Conhecimento. Formato: knowledge-assistants/{knowledge_assistant_id}.
Opções
Examples
O exemplo seguinte sincroniza todas as fontes de conhecimento para um assistente:
databricks knowledge-assistants sync-knowledge-sources knowledge-assistants/my-assistant-id
Databricks Assistentes de Conhecimento de Atualização-Assistente de Conhecimento
Atualize um Assistente de Conhecimento.
databricks knowledge-assistants update-knowledge-assistant NAME UPDATE_MASK DISPLAY_NAME DESCRIPTION [flags]
Arguments
NAME
O nome do recurso do Assistente de Conhecimento. Formato: knowledge-assistants/{knowledge_assistant_id}.
UPDATE_MASK
Lista delimitada por vírgulas de campos a atualizar. Valores permitidos: display_name, description, instructions.
DISPLAY_NAME
O nome de exibição do Assistente de Conhecimento.
DESCRIPTION
Descrição do que este assistente pode fazer.
Opções
--instructions string
Instruções globais adicionais sobre como o agente deve gerar respostas.
--json JSON
A cadeia de caracteres JSON embutida ou o @path para o arquivo JSON com o corpo da solicitação.
--name string
O nome do recurso do Assistente de Conhecimento.
Examples
O exemplo seguinte atualiza o nome de exibição de um Assistente de Conhecimento:
databricks knowledge-assistants update-knowledge-assistant knowledge-assistants/my-assistant-id display_name "Updated Sales Assistant" "Answers questions about sales data"
Databricks Knowledge-Assistants atualizar-knowledge-source
Atualize uma fonte de conhecimento.
databricks knowledge-assistants update-knowledge-source NAME UPDATE_MASK DISPLAY_NAME DESCRIPTION SOURCE_TYPE [flags]
Arguments
NAME
O nome do recurso da fonte de conhecimento a atualizar. Formato: knowledge-assistants/{knowledge_assistant_id}/knowledge-sources/{knowledge_source_id}.
UPDATE_MASK
Lista delimitada por vírgulas de campos a atualizar. Valores permitidos: display_name, description.
DISPLAY_NAME
Nome de visualização legível por humanos da fonte de conhecimento.
DESCRIPTION
Descrição da fonte de conhecimento.
SOURCE_TYPE
O tipo da fonte. Este campo é ignorado na atualização.
Opções
--json JSON
A cadeia de caracteres JSON embutida ou o @path para o arquivo JSON com o corpo da solicitação.
--name string
Nome completo do recurso: knowledge-assistants/{knowledge_assistant_id}/knowledge-sources/{knowledge_source_id}.
Examples
O exemplo seguinte atualiza uma fonte de conhecimento:
databricks knowledge-assistants update-knowledge-source knowledge-assistants/my-assistant-id/knowledge-sources/my-source-id display_name "Updated Sales Docs" "Updated documentation about sales" files
Bandeiras globais
--debug
Se o log de depuração deve ser habilitado.
-h ou --help
Exiba a ajuda para a CLI do Databricks ou para o grupo de comandos relacionado ou para o comando relacionado.
--log-file String
Uma cadeia de caracteres que representa o ficheiro onde os registos de saída são gravados. Se esse sinalizador não for especificado, o padrão é gravar logs de saída no stderr.
--log-format Formato
O tipo de formato de log, text ou json. O valor predefinido é text.
--log-level String
Uma cadeia de caracteres que representa o nível de formato de log. Se não for especificado, o nível de formato de log será desativado.
-o, --output tipo
O tipo de saída do comando, text ou json. O valor predefinido é text.
-p, --profile String
O nome do perfil no arquivo ~/.databrickscfg a usar para executar o comando. Se esse sinalizador não for especificado, se ele existir, o perfil nomeado DEFAULT será usado.
--progress-format Formato
O formato para exibir logs de progresso: default, append, inplace, ou json
-t, --target String
Se aplicável, o destino do pacote a ser usado